John Bowle was the first scholar to consider Don Quixote a masterpiece. His edition, published in six volumes in 1781, “the first truly learned edition”, established a foundation for future study and editing of Cervantes's great work. Here, Cox explores the life and works of John Bowle, and considers his lasting legacy.
